Did you try to Install it to your harddrive and play it from there? I have a burnout disc, that is cracked and wont go past the main menu if playing on the disc, but I installed it to the Harddrive and all it needs to do is read the disc in the tray so the name comes up, then you play from the Harddrive and it doesnt use your disc while you are playing.

this is gonna sound stupid but:

smooth peanut butter...smoosh some on, use your (clean, like wash before hand) finger to swirl around in circles around the disk, like 3 times (itty bitty overlapping circles, until you've been around the whole cd 3 times).press hard and dont be a wuss, put it on the counter so you dont bend and break it. Then run it under a tap and use your finger to get it all off. finish with a microfiber cloth or soft towel. Then take a (new, as in unused and undirtied) hi-liter and basically color it in, in small overlapping circles (for both of these think of waxing your car...peanut butter is like a cutting compound and the highliter is like a wax, use the same motion and everything)

then wash off and clean with a nice soft cloth. if that doesnt work, its too messed up. I've brought a lot back from the death this way. and somehow it works better than even like mother's plastic polish.
